About the procedure
Procedure Overview
Rhinoplasty, commonly known as nose surgery, is a surgical procedure that reshapes the nasal structure to improve facial harmony, correct breathing issues, or address congenital or traumatic deformities. Techniques range from augmentation using implants or cartilage grafts to reduction of the nasal bridge, tip refinement, nostril reshaping, and functional septoplasty. The procedure is tailored to each patient's anatomy, aesthetic goals, and ethnic features, with Korean rhinoplasty techniques emphasizing natural contours and balanced proportions that complement Asian facial structures.

Process and Recovery
Rhinoplasty in Apgujeong typically begins with a comprehensive consultation involving 3D imaging and detailed surgical planning. The procedure is performed under general anesthesia and lasts two to four hours depending on complexity. Surgeons may use open or closed techniques, with incisions hidden inside the nostrils or along the columella. Post-operatively, patients wear a nasal splint for one to two weeks, with initial swelling subsiding within ten to fourteen days. Most patients resume light activities within a week, though complete healing and final contour refinement continue over six to twelve months. - Q. What is the recovery timeline and recommended stay in Seoul?
- A. Initial recovery involves splint removal at seven to ten days post-surgery, with most swelling reducing over two to three weeks. Patients typically stay in Seoul for ten to fourteen days to complete initial follow-ups, though some clinics accommodate shorter or longer timelines.
